Neelambur Masjid (Palli Vasal)

Neelambur Masjid (Palli Vasal)

Neelambur Masjid, commonly known as Palli Vasal, serves as a peaceful and welcoming place of worship for the Muslim community residing in and around Neelambur. Located along Avinashi Road, the masjid provides a serene environment for daily prayers, religious gatherings, and spiritual reflection amidst the rapidly developing surroundings of Coimbatore’s eastern corridor. Known for its simplicity and community warmth, the masjid brings together worshippers from nearby residential areas and industrial zones, offering a space where faith, unity, and devotion come together. Its accessible location and active congregation make it a vital spiritual centre for both residents and commuters.
